The variation in polymer structures is observed when the backone of the polymer molecule contains a carbon atom attached to two different side groups. Such polymers can have different configurational arrangements or tacticity. [Pg.60]

Replacement of the conventional incoherent light source with a laser has allowed CD measurements to be made on extremely small samples, such as those encountered in capillary electrophoresis. In addition, the unique spatial properties of the laser are utilized to advantage in thermal lens spectroscopy. TL detection of CD, either via a single beam, or a differentially configured arrangement, has demonstrated significant improvements in the measurement SNR. Application to HPLC detection, or time-resolved studies, are currently under investigation. [Pg.50]

Microstates are the atomic states that result from interactions between electrons in a many electron system (mi and ms values). The microstate table lists all the possible microstates for a given electron configuration arranged according to the Ml and Ms values. In the case of a np2 configuration the microstate table will be of the form... [Pg.86]

In the late 1960s, as part of an effort devoted to the preparation of high-order annulene polyoxides, J. A. Elix attempted a Wittig-type self-condensation of 5-formyl-2-furfurylphosphonium chloride 1.19 While the products that resulted were predominantly polymeric, small quantities of macrocyclic products were isolated. These latter consisted of trimers, tetramers, and pentamers (discussed in Chapters 2, 4, and 6, respectively), as well as a hexamer. Unfortunately, this hex-americ [36]annulene hexoxide product represented by structure 7.80, was only obtained in 0.05% yield (Scheme 7.7.1). Thus, Elix was unable to elucidate the exact configurational arrangement of the double bonds in this product. Still, as discussed below, this issue could be addressed at least in part, by spectroscopic means. [Pg.358]

As a corollary, N-monosubstituted and unsymmetrically /V-disubstituted derivatives are expected to exhibit (E)-(Z) geometrical isomerism. In the case of N,Nr-unsymmetrically disubstituted thioureas, up to four different configurational arrangements can be envisaged, the (E,E) isomer being generally absent because of steric repulsion between the nitrogen substituents (Fig. 3). [Pg.38]

Bismuth(III) acetate reacts with cyclohexene to produce 1,2-diacetatocyclohexane. If conditions exclude water, a trans configuration arrangement of the two acetate groups is obtained, while the configuration is cis if water is included in the reaction (equations 14 and 15). ... [Pg.360]

As an example for a one-dimensional property transfer, the preparation of optically active co-polymers using chiral template molecules is described. In this case, the optical activity in the polymer arises from the chirality of the configurational arrangement of the main chain (main chain chirality). Symmetry considerations show that there are several possible structures both for stereoregular homo- and for co-polymers in which this type of chirality can be expected [4]. [Pg.40]

Stereoisomers are compounds having the same number and kinds of atoms, the same configuration (arrangement) of bonds, but altogether different 3D-structures i.e., they specifically differ in the 3D-arrangements of atoms in space. [Pg.50]

Enantiomers are isomers whose 3D-configuration (arrangement) of atoms gives rise to the formation of nonsuperimposable mirror images. [Pg.50]

Polymerization of olehns results in the variation of geometrical and configurational arrangements (named tacticity) [8]. Having control of these arrangements is an issue of particular importance because tacticity affects the physical properties of the polymer. [Pg.58]
